Last year at the end of March, Harrison proposed! Amazingly, our close friends, Howard and Jie, also proposed within the same week without knowing each others plans. A little scary, isn’t it?! The toughest decision after that was to decide the wedding location and time. Due to my younger sister’s wedding plans and the superstitious side of me, we moved the date many times before finally coming to a conclusion - we’d have the Chinese engagement party in Taiwan on June 19, 2005 and the western wedding here in the bay area on the Sunday of the Thanksgiving weekend, which was also the weekend that we first met 4 years ago. After that, everything just flew by…
Mom was in charge of the whole preparation of our engagement party in Taiwan which was a huge task. Without us being around, she did everything for this huge 400-guest banquet in my home town, I-Lan, Taiwan. I want to thank my dearest Mom for making such a wonderful party come true. In the short trip to Taiwan last June, Harrison and I also took the opportunity to have our engagement/wedding photos done by a Taipei photo studio. It is the Asian tradition!
Looking back, I do not know how I pulled everything off with only 5 months of preparations. I visited no less than 20 wedding venues from Carmel to Napa; talked to more than 10 photographers, 10 videographers, and numerous different vendors. With Harrison’s and many friends’ help, we hand-made the save-the-day cards and wedding invitations. Harrison spent a week on the english and chinese versions of the wedding slideshow. We also went to a lot of food tasting which Harrison thought it’s the best part of the process (of course, he’s only responsible for the “tasting” part!)
